Diatoms: Creators of Glass Castles
- Almost 300 years ago the Dutchman Anton van Leeuwenhoek created a model of microscope with 300-fold magnification and saw a strange brownish "boat" crawled in the slide. He called it the "oat animal"
- It would be fair to say that every other breath of oxygen that we breathe comes from diatoms, those invisible workers
- In this sense the frustule structure of many diatoms is perfect from the point of view of an engineer and designer
